Picking the Right Type
The first step in starting a livestock farm is to choose the right type of livestock for your particular goals and needs. Some prominent beef cattle breeds include Angus, Hereford, and Charolais, known for their top notch meat production.

It's important to take into consideration factors such as climate, available sources, and market demand when selecting a type. For beginners, we suggest beginning with a flexible breed that is fit to your local conditions and can adjust quickly to different management methods.

Real estate and Framework
Developing a comfy and risk-free living setting for your livestock is critical for their well-being and productivity. Depending on the size of your procedure, you may need to invest in various types of real estate and facilities for your cattle.

It's necessary to offer ample room, air flow, and tidy alcohol consumption water for your livestock to avoid health concerns and make sure optimum development. Additionally, appropriate fencing and protection procedures are necessary to avoid escapes and safeguard the herd from predators.

Nutrition and Feeding
Correct nutrition is essential to preserving the health and wellness and performance of your livestock. Livestock require a well balanced diet regimen that consists of a mix of lawn, hay, grains, and supplements to fulfill their dietary demands. Fields are an excellent source of nourishment for livestock, providing important minerals and vitamins for healthy and balanced growth.

Supplemental feeding may be essential, specifically during the wintertime months or when field top quality is low. Seek advice from a veterinarian or nutritionist to establish a feeding program that fulfills the particular needs of your cattle and aids maximize their efficiency.

Wellness Management
Ensuring the health and health of your livestock is critical to the success of your farming operation. Regular medical examination, inoculations, and preventative care are important to stop condition episodes and keep a healthy herd. Deal with a certified vet to create a detailed health management strategy for your cattle, including inoculation schedules, bloodsucker control, and condition monitoring.

It's also vital to maintain comprehensive records of your livestock's wellness history, including vaccinations, therapies, and any signs of ailment. By carefully keeping an eye on the health and wellness of your herd, you can detect prospective issues early and take positive actions to avoid expensive or damaging illness.

Breeding and Reproduction
Reproduction is an important part of livestock farming, as it determines the future development and productivity of your herd. Whether you're concentrated on beef or dairy products production, a well-planned reproduction program can assist you achieve your reproducing objectives and boost the hereditary quality of your cattle.

There are numerous breeding approaches to consider, including natural mating, synthetic insemination, and embryo transfer. Collaborate with a certified vet or reproducing professional to create a breeding technique that aligns with your goals and makes sure the long-term success of your cattle farming procedure.

Market Opportunities
As a livestock farmer, it's vital to have a clear understanding of market fads and chances to make the most of the productivity of your procedure. Whether you're offering beef, milk products, or reproducing stock, it is essential to research market demand, pricing, and circulation channels to make informed decisions concerning your company.

Recognizing particular niche markets, such as natural or grass-fed beef, can assist separate your products and attract premium rates. Connect with neighborhood farmers, processors, and distributors to discover possible collaborations and expand your market reach.
